Overview

The Lady Tasting Tea is not a book of dry facts and figures, but the history of great individuals who dared to look at the world in a new way. Examines the works of statistics pioneer Ronald Fisher as well as other revolutionary thinkers in the field, covering the rise and fall of Karl Pearson''s theories, the methods that contributed to Japan''s post-war rebuilding, a pivotal early study on a Guinness beer cask, and more.
